Что предстоит делать:
- Написание постановок для разработки витрин в СУБД ClickHouse
-
анализ бизнес-потребностей заказчика в структуре продуктовой команды
-
выстраивание процесса обмена данными микросервисов и NearRealTime слоя Data
-
формализация интерфейсов в виде контрактов API
-
формализация сценариев интеграций в виде sequence-диаграмм
-
поддержание технической документацию продукта в актуальном состоянии
Что мы ожидаем от кандидата:
-
Уверенное знание SQL
-
Понимание процессов оптимизации запросов, опыт работы с различными источниками (особенно важен опыт работы с Kafka)
-
Опыт работы с ClickHouse от 2-х лет
-
хорошее знание различных типов интеграций между сервисами, их преимуществ и недостатков
-
понимание стиля REST
-
понимание принципа работы и особенностей Kafka (или RabbitMQ)
-
понимание особенностей микросервисной архитектуры
-
опыт проектирования API